That's a good point. You can't play Niefelheim successfully or competitively, purely by creating Niefel giants.

As tough as they are, they're too expensive to use as a main army until late game, and you've got lots of other tough, useful troops.

Niefel giants are there to make a good army unbeatable, they're not there to provide that army, all by themselves.

To do so would be like building a navy that consisted only of battleships.

A very effective tactic against Niefelhiem is ritual spells which cause unrest. Get unrest to over 100 in their capital and keep it there. Boom, no more Frost Giants. Rain of Toads, Raging Hearts, Plague of Locusts, Baleful Star, Blight and Hurricane are the spells you want.

How good are these giants at sieges? Can they be starved easily? I know I tend to take death scales as Agartha and I have a province as low as 86 food- and this is only two provinces distant from my capital. Size five, 30 Niefels, 120 food? You could probably starve them.

On the other hand, with a strength of 25, they'd have a siege strength of 6.25 x 30, or 187. It would be difficult (though not impossible) to hold off that force, but if your armies will be defeated in the field, than why not fort up? (other than losing the chance to counter-raid).

EA Niefelheim is powerful but has many exploitable weaknesses. Many of which have been listed already.

EA Nielfelheim can recruit specific troops for sieging, the rock hurlers. They get a decent siege bonus.

Of course, as Niefel, you are always concerned about Flaming Arrows and other instances of concentrated fire magic. Casting Rain on the first round of combat is a good idea for the Niefel player. With Rain and a nature bless, Niefel giants can hold up to large volleys of Flaming Arrows.

When I play Niefel, I seldom, if ever, buy the Niefel giants. I stick to the
Jotun hirdmen. In the early game the big guys are too expensive. In the middle
game, buying Niefel jarls at the capital is so important that there is no money
to spend on Niefel giants. In the late game, the Niefel giants are irrelevant.
Nice to have, maybe, but if my opponent is worth anything, he is loaded for jarl,
and in that case the giants are just chafe. The Jotun hirdmen do most of what
Niefel giants do, at a fraction of the price.
